Utility Plugin Tutorials

The Utility plugin is a handy Ableton Live device that allows you to adjust gain, panning, invert phase, and more.

Using the Ableton Live Utility Plugin on Return Tracks. Ableton Live users can use the Utility plugin for even better control of effects. Return tracks allow you to blend uneffected audio with effected audio. A side effect of using return tracks is that they boost the overall volume of the track.
